| /devicemodel/hw/ |
| A D | usb_core.c | 190 if (path) { in usb_native_is_device_existed() 192 usb_dev_path(path)); in usb_native_is_device_existed() 227 usb_dev_path(struct usb_devpath *path) in usb_dev_path() argument 232 if (!path) in usb_dev_path() 236 r -= snprintf(output, n, "%d", path->path[0]); in usb_dev_path() 238 for (i = 1; i < path->depth; i++) { in usb_dev_path() 239 r -= snprintf(output + n - r, r, ".%d", path->path[i]); in usb_dev_path() 254 memcmp(p1->path, p2->path, p1->depth) == 0); in usb_dev_path_cmp() 258 usb_get_hub_port_num(struct usb_devpath *path) in usb_get_hub_port_num() argument 265 if (!usb_native_is_bus_existed(path->bus)) in usb_get_hub_port_num() [all …]
|
| A D | uart_core.c | 874 uart_open_backend(struct uart_backend *be, const char *path, in uart_open_backend() argument 891 fd = open(path, O_RDWR | O_NONBLOCK); in uart_open_backend() 893 WPRINTF(("uart: open failed: %s\n", path)); in uart_open_backend() 895 WPRINTF(("uart: not a tty: %s\n", path)); in uart_open_backend() 1004 const char *path = NULL; in uart_set_backend() local 1035 path = opts; in uart_set_backend() 1043 retval = uart_open_backend(be, path, be_type); in uart_set_backend()
|
| /devicemodel/core/ |
| A D | sw_load_ovmf.c | 153 char *path, *addr; in acrn_prepare_ovmf() local 159 path = ovmf_file_name; in acrn_prepare_ovmf() 172 fd = open(path, flags); in acrn_prepare_ovmf() 176 path, strerror(errno)); in acrn_prepare_ovmf() 190 path, strerror(errno)); in acrn_prepare_ovmf() 239 path, strerror(errno)); in acrn_prepare_ovmf() 250 path); in acrn_prepare_ovmf() 255 path, size, addr); in acrn_prepare_ovmf() 327 char *path; in acrn_writeback_ovmf_nvstorage() local 354 path, strerror(errno)); in acrn_writeback_ovmf_nvstorage() [all …]
|
| A D | hugetlb.c | 544 char path[MAX_PATH_LEN] = {0}; in init_hugetlb() local 551 snprintf(path, MAX_PATH_LEN, "%s/", ACRN_HUGETLB_LOCK_DIR); in init_hugetlb() 552 len = strnlen(path, MAX_PATH_LEN); in init_hugetlb() 554 if (path[i] == '/') { in init_hugetlb() 555 path[i] = 0; in init_hugetlb() 556 if (access(path, F_OK) != 0) { in init_hugetlb() 557 if (mkdir(path, 0755) < 0) { in init_hugetlb() 562 pr_err("mkdir %s failed: %s\n", path, errormsg(errno)); in init_hugetlb() 567 path[i] = '/'; in init_hugetlb()
|
| A D | monitor.c | 465 char path[128] = {}; in monitor_init() local 479 snprintf(path, sizeof(path) - 1, "%s.monitor", vmname); in monitor_init() 481 monitor_fd = mngr_open_un(path, MNGR_SERVER); in monitor_init()
|
| A D | sw_load_common.c | 135 check_image(char *path, size_t size_limit, size_t *size) in check_image() argument 140 fp = fopen(path, "r"); in check_image()
|
| /devicemodel/hw/platform/ |
| A D | usb_pmapper.c | 38 info->path.depth = libusb_get_port_numbers(ldev, info->path.path, in usb_get_native_devinfo() 44 info->path.bus, usb_dev_path(&info->path)); in usb_get_native_devinfo() 53 else if (info->path.path[1] == 0) in usb_get_native_devinfo() 539 path = &udev->info.path; in usb_dev_native_toggle_if() 564 path->bus, usb_dev_path(path), c, i, in usb_dev_native_toggle_if() 585 path = &udev->info.path; in usb_dev_native_toggle_if_drivers() 608 "\r\n", path->bus, usb_dev_path(path), in usb_dev_native_toggle_if_drivers() 908 path = &udev->info.path; in clear_uas_desc() 920 path->bus, usb_dev_path(path)); in clear_uas_desc() 1182 sz = sizeof(udev->info.path.path[0]); in usb_dev_info() [all …]
|
| /devicemodel/hw/pci/ |
| A D | xhci.c | 633 path = &di.path; in pci_xhci_assign_hub_ports() 637 memcpy(path->path, info->path.path, info->path.depth); in pci_xhci_assign_hub_ports() 638 memcpy(path->path + info->path.depth, &i, sizeof(i)); in pci_xhci_assign_hub_ports() 639 memset(path->path + info->path.depth + 1, 0, in pci_xhci_assign_hub_ports() 642 path->bus = info->path.bus; in pci_xhci_assign_hub_ports() 679 path = &di.path; in pci_xhci_unassign_hub_ports() 683 memcpy(path->path, oldinfo->path.path, oldinfo->path.depth); in pci_xhci_unassign_hub_ports() 684 memcpy(path->path + oldinfo->path.depth, &i, sizeof(i)); in pci_xhci_unassign_hub_ports() 685 memset(path->path + oldinfo->path.depth + 1, 0, in pci_xhci_unassign_hub_ports() 4184 path.path[0] = port; in pci_xhci_parse_bus_port() [all …]
|
| A D | gvt.c | 303 const char *path = "/sys/kernel/gvt/control/create_gvt_instance"; in gvt_create_instance() local 306 gvt->gvt_file = fopen(path, "w"); in gvt_create_instance() 308 WPRINTF(("GVT: open %s failed\n", path)); in gvt_create_instance() 344 const char *path = "/sys/kernel/gvt/control/create_gvt_instance"; in gvt_destroy_instance() local 347 gvt->gvt_file = fopen(path, "w"); in gvt_destroy_instance() 349 WPRINTF(("gvt: error: open %s failed", path)); in gvt_destroy_instance()
|
| /devicemodel/arch/x86/ |
| A D | power_button.c | 100 char path[256] = {0}; in open_power_button_input_device() local 117 rc = snprintf(path, sizeof(path), "%s/%s", in open_power_button_input_device() 119 if (rc < 0 || rc >= sizeof(path)) { in open_power_button_input_device() 129 nevent = scandir(path, &event_dirs, event_dir_filter, in open_power_button_input_device() 133 path); in open_power_button_input_device()
|
| /devicemodel/include/ |
| A D | usb_core.h | 184 uint8_t path[USB_MAX_TIERS]; member 186 #define ROOTHUB_PORT(x) ((x).path[0]) 195 struct usb_devpath path; member 247 int usb_native_is_device_existed(struct usb_devpath *path); 250 int usb_get_hub_port_num(struct usb_devpath *path); 251 char *usb_dev_path(struct usb_devpath *path);
|
| A D | sw_load.h | 73 int check_image(char *path, size_t size_limit, size_t *size);
|
| /devicemodel/core/cmd_monitor/ |
| A D | socket.h | 72 struct socket_dev *init_socket(char *path);
|
| A D | socket.c | 293 struct socket_dev *init_socket(char *path) in init_socket() argument 303 strncpy(sock->unix_sock_path, path, UNIX_SOCKET_PATH_MAX - 1); in init_socket()
|
| /devicemodel/hw/pci/virtio/ |
| A D | virtio_console.c | 590 virtio_console_open_backend(const char *path, in virtio_console_open_backend() argument 617 fd = open(path, O_RDWR | O_NONBLOCK); in virtio_console_open_backend() 619 WPRINTF(("vtcon: open failed: %s\n", path)); in virtio_console_open_backend() 621 WPRINTF(("vtcon: not a tty: %s\n", path)); in virtio_console_open_backend() 627 fd = open(path, O_WRONLY|O_CREAT|O_APPEND|O_NONBLOCK, 0666); in virtio_console_open_backend() 629 WPRINTF(("vtcon: open failed: %s\n", path)); in virtio_console_open_backend()
|
| A D | virtio_gpio.c | 711 char path[64] = {0}; in native_gpio_open_chip() local 714 snprintf(path, sizeof(path), "/dev/%s", name); in native_gpio_open_chip() 715 fd = open(path, O_RDWR); in native_gpio_open_chip() 718 path, strerror(errno))); in native_gpio_open_chip() 726 path, strerror(errno))); in native_gpio_open_chip() 733 path, chip->ngpio, strerror(errno))); in native_gpio_open_chip()
|
| A D | virtio_mei.c | 902 char path[256]; in vmei_read_fw_status() local 910 offset = snprintf(path, sizeof(path) - 1, "%s/%s/%s", in vmei_read_fw_status() 915 if (mei_sysfs_read_property_file(path, buf, sizeof(buf) - 1) < 0) in vmei_read_fw_status() 2206 char path[256]; in vmei_get_devname() local 2211 snprintf(path, sizeof(path), in vmei_get_devname() 2215 if (stat(path, &buf) < 0) in vmei_get_devname() 2218 n = scandir(path, &namelist, filter_dirs, alphasort); in vmei_get_devname()
|